"SUMIRE AOI HOUSE" is a small Japanese house. The basic structure of the house was designed in 1952 by Makoto Masuzawa, a leading architect in Japan. And the house was redesigned by Makoto Koizumi in 1999. I had lived 20 years with my family. The sense of space by the south-facing large windows and the stairwell, it will make you attracted.
